Solution for 20+5x+y=0 equation:


Simplifying
20 + 5x + y = 0

Solving
20 + 5x + y =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-20' to each side of the equation.
20 + 5x + -20 + y = 0 + -20

Reorder the terms:
20 + -20 + 5x + y = 0 + -20

Combine like terms: 20 + -20 = 0
0 + 5x + y = 0 + -20
5x + y = 0 + -20

Combine like terms: 0 + -20 = -20
5x + y = -20

Add '-1y' to each side of the equation.
5x + y + -1y = -20 + -1y

Combine like terms: y + -1y = 0
5x + 0 = -20 + -1y
5x = -20 + -1y

Divide each side by '5'.
x = -4 + -0.2y

Simplifying
x = -4 + -0.2y
